Từ vựng:

contempt against judge

Giải nghĩa:

/kənˈtempt əˈɡɛnst dʒʌdʒ/ – Phrase


Definition: sự coi thường thẩm phán.

A more thorough explanation: Contempt against a judge refers to any act or behavior that shows disrespect, defiance, or disregard for the authority, dignity, or orders of a judge in a court of law. This can include actions such as disrupting court proceedings, disobeying court orders, or making disrespectful remarks towards the judge. Contempt of court is a serious offense that can result in penalties such as fines, imprisonment, or other sanctions imposed by the court.

Example: The defendant was found guilty of contempt against the judge for repeatedly interrupting the court proceedings and making disrespectful remarks.
